Matchday Logistics and Global Broadcast Access

For fans looking to catch the Hamilton Tiger-Cats in action, the 2026 season offers more accessibility than ever before. Tim Hortons Field continues to provide a premier fan experience, featuring social viewing decks and a diverse range of local culinary options. Tickets for remaining home games are in high demand, particularly for the upcoming divisional matchups that will likely decide playoff seeding.



  • Television Broadcasts: All Tiger-Cats games are broadcast live on TSN and RDS for viewers across Canada.
  • Digital Streaming: International fans can access live games via CFL+, the league’s official streaming platform for viewers outside of North America.
  • Radio Coverage: Local play-by-play remains a staple, with live audio available on the Tiger-Cats' flagship radio partners and through the official team app.
  • Gate Times: For home games at Tim Hortons Field, gates typically open 90 minutes prior to kickoff, allowing fans to enjoy pre-game festivities in the Stipley area.

Security and entry protocols for 2026 remain streamlined, with digital ticketing being the primary method of access. Fans are encouraged to utilize local transit options, including the HSR, which often provides "Tiger-Cat Express" services on game days to alleviate congestion around the stadium.
